The Importance of Physical Fitness

Physical fitness forms the cornerstone of healthy aging. Regular exercise not only enhances cardiovascular health and muscular strength but also improves flexibility, balance, and coordination. Engaging in activities such as walking, swimming, yoga, or strength training helps to preserve mobility and independence as we age.

Maintaining a Balanced Diet

Nutrition plays a pivotal role in healthy aging. Consuming a well-balanced diet rich in fruits, vegetables, lean proteins, and whole grains provides essential nutrients that support overall health. As we age, it becomes imperative to focus on nutrient-dense foods to meet our body's changing needs and reduce the risk of chronic diseases.

Prioritizing Mental Well-being

Cognitive health is integral to healthy aging. Stimulating the mind through activities like reading, puzzles, or learning new skills helps to preserve cognitive function and ward off age-related cognitive decline. Additionally, practicing mindfulness, meditation, and stress-reduction techniques promotes emotional well-being and resilience.

Incorporating Social Connections

Maintaining strong social connections is key to healthy aging. Engaging in social activities, spending time with loved ones, and participating in community events foster a sense of belonging and fulfillment. Cultivating meaningful relationships contributes to emotional support and reduces feelings of loneliness and isolation.
